The democratization of ubiquitous computing (access data anywhere, anytime, anyhow), the increasing connection of corporate databases to the Internet and the today's natural resort to Web-hosting companies strongly emphasize the need for data confidentiality. Database servers arouse user's suspicion because no one can fully trust traditional security mechanisms against more and more frequent and malicious attacks and no one can be fully confident on an invisible DBA administering confidential data. This paper gives an in-depth analysis of existing security solutions and concludes on the intrinsic weakness of the traditional server-based approach to preserve data confidentiality. With this statement in mind, we propose a solution called C-SDA (Chip-Secured Data Access), which enforces data confidentiality and controls personal privileges thanks to a client-based security component acting as a mediator between a client and an encrypted database. This component is embedded in a smartcard to prevent any tampering to occur. This cooperation of hardware and software security components constitutes a strong guarantee against attacks threatening personal as well as business data.
